Lederle Lane is in Gosport and in Gosport district. PO13 0FZ is located in the Bridgemary electoral ward, within the English Parliamentary constituency of Gosport. This postcode has been in use since 2004-07-01.

People

Gender

In the UK, the overall gender distribution is approximately 49% male and 51% female. However, the area surrounding PO13 0FZ, has a female population slightly higher than UK average, with 53.6% of residents being female. Several factors can contribute to this. Women generally live longer than men, resulting in a higher proportion of women in neighborhoods with significant elderly populations. Typically, as people grow older, they tend to relocate from city center addresses to suburban areas, smaller towns, and rural locations. Consequently, these areas often have a higher number of females. A higher female population can also be found in areas with industries that employ more women, such as healthcare, education, and retail.

Safety

Is Lederle Lane Street dangerous?

Over the last 12 months, the overall crime rate around Lederle Lane was 96.5 per 1,000 residents, which is 5.0% higher than the Bridgemary average. The most reported crime type was Violence and sexual offences.

Lederle Lane has the 14th highest crime rate of 48 local areas in Bridgemary and the 89th highest crime rate of 267 local areas in Gosport .

Violent and sexual offences accounted for around 77.2 crimes per 1,000 residents and have been falling year on year. Over the last decade, overall crime has fallen by about -47.1%.
